About Jennifer

Jennifer Plesz is a Certified Rehabilitation Counselor and Licensed Professional Counselor (CRC, LPC) with over 10 years of professional experience helping clients to overcome anxiety, family conflict, relationship difficulties, pregnancy and postpartum related issues, stress, anger issues, ADHD, women's issues, and much more. 

Jennifer earned her Master's degree in Rehabilitation Counseling from Wayne State University, and has several years of experience working with people from all backgrounds. Today Jennifer offers individual, couples, and families who experiencing hard times, or new obstacles.
